👀 SPOILER-FREE SUMMARY

Halfway through the season, Tonegawa faces one of his most absurd assignments yet—finding a convincing body double for the eccentric President Hyoudou. This is pure workplace comedy at its most ridiculous, leaning hard into the show's strength of turning mundane corporate tasks into high-stakes farce. The episode introduces Masayan, whose personality clashes with the Teiai corporate world provide fresh comedic fuel. Expect dialogue-heavy scenes punctuated by sharp situational humor, with Tonegawa's exasperation serving as the emotional anchor. The pacing is relaxed and confident, letting the absurdity of the premise breathe rather than rushing through gags. If you've enjoyed the series' knack for mining comedy from middle-management misery, this episode delivers exactly that energy with a fun new wrinkle. A strong midseason entry that keeps the laughs consistent.

📍 ARC CONTEXT

Sitting at the exact midpoint of the 24-episode run, Episode 12 pivots from the corporate travel headaches of Episode 11's 'Business Trip' to a more character-focused comedic premise centered on Hyoudou's eccentricities. It deepens the dynamic between Tonegawa and his impossible boss while introducing Masayan as a new source of chaos. This episode bridges into Episode 13, 'Setting Sail,' which continues exploring the internal politics and interpersonal absurdity within the Teiai Corporation.
